    I have Whitaker #1 pound for pound. This is not the first time nor will it be the last time that I make this statment. Any ranking is opinion and in my opinion Pernell Whitaker is #1.
    I base my ranking on the combonation of 1. His boxing abilities he was as good as if not better than anyone else who ever steped in to a boxing ring. His defense was one of the best of all time. I only rank Nicolino Locche higher and it is close. He also had an outstanding work rate on offense and at lightweight had decent power 13 knockouts in 26 wins. 2. his acomplishments His wining world tittles in four difrent weights. 3. His level of compotion. He has wins over Greg Haugen, Jose Luis Ramirez (2nd fight,), Freddie Pendleton, Azumah Nelson, Juan Nazario, Jorge Paez, Rafael Pineda, James McGirt(X2) and Julio Cesar Vasquez. I realize that not every one on that list is a Hall of Famer but they were the best of his era. His loss to Jose Luis Ramirez is considered to be one of the worse robberies in boxing history. His draw with Julio Cesar Chavez is right up there as well. In his prime he out preformed all of his poents the only blimishes on his record (prime) were the questionable decisions to Ramirez and Chavez. And no he did not run in the Chavez fight.. He was at least compititive with Oscar De La Hoya he might have been past his prime and De La Hoya in his prime. but Whitaker past his prime is still pretty good. His loss to Felix Trinidad was after a 16 month lay off.
    Fell free to disagree with me I won't fell insulted nor will I tell you that are wrong in having someone else at #1 P4P My guess is Robinson or Greb. P4P rankings are opinion and not fact and in My opinion for the reasons stated above it is my opinion that Pernell Whitaker is the best boxer of all time.
